BEHAVIOUR IN THE DOJO

1. The student must arrive at the dojo before the class begins. If arriving late, the student performs the initial bows towards the shomen and to the instructor by him/herself, remains seated in seiza and asks the instructor for permission to join the class before rising and joining practice.

2. When entering and leaving the dojo, students bow towards the shomen twice – first while standing and then again while sitting in seiza The meaning of this bow is to show respect towards one’s training partners and towards the dojo.

3. Before and after a practice students perform two bows, the first of which shows respect towards the principles of budo and the second of which shows respect towards the other people at the dojo.

4. A student must keep his or her training clothes tidy and must not wear rings, watches, necklaces or other objects that may cause injury to others during practice.

5. The student must show serious attitude and concentration towards training. Idle conversation, loud laughing and other disturbing behaviour must be avoided.

6. The teacher's instructions must be followed promptly and precisely.

7. In order to maintain proper budo spirit the student must avoid all emotional outbursts. Such feelings and behaviour as anger, contempt and mocking others have no place in the dojo.

8. If a student must leave practice early, he or she must inform the instructor of this and ask for a permission to leave, after which he or she must perform the final bows by him/herself when leaving the dojo.

9. The teacher has the right to remove such people who do not follow these instructions from the dojo A student who uses the skills and techniques taught at the dojo to intentionally harm other people without a clear need to defend him or herself will be banned temporarily from practicing or expelled completely from the dojo.

10. The main goals of practicing budo are: to strengthen one's character and to learn sincerity, perseverance, politeness and self-discipline.
